Add 25/14 and 21/60

1st number: 1 11/14, 2nd number: 21/60

25/14 + 21/60 is 299/140.

Steps for adding fractions

  1. Find the least common denominator or LCM of the two denominators:
    LCM of 14 and 60 is 420

    Next, find the equivalent fraction of both fractional numbers with denominator 420
  2. For the 1st fraction, since 14 × 30 = 420,
    25/14 = 25 × 30/14 × 30 = 750/420
  3. Likewise, for the 2nd fraction, since 60 × 7 = 420,
    21/60 = 21 × 7/60 × 7 = 147/420
  4. Add the two like fractions:
    750/420 + 147/420 = 750 + 147/420 = 897/420
  5. 897/420 simplified gives 299/140
  6. So, 25/14 + 21/60 = 299/140
    In mixed form: 219/140
